MásMóvil from loss to €189m profit; debt surges

Awaiting the merger with Orange to become the largest operator in Spain in terms of customers, MásMóvil has reported a net profit of €189 million versus €77 million losses in 2020 and €93 million in 2019. DAZN, Movistar Plus+ score La Liga deal

DAZN, the sports streaming platform, has closed a non-exclusive distribution deal with Movistar Plus+, the entertainment platform in Spain, for La Liga football starting next season. Forecast: Streamers 20% of sports rights spend in Europe in 2022

Streaming services will be responsible for one-fifth of all sports rights spend this year across Europe’s largest markets according to Ampere Analysis research, covering nearly 1,300 rights deals. Spain: Streaming platforms mean reduced piracy

TV piracy is in decline thanks to the boom of streaming platforms in Spain, according to a report by OBS Business School.  It says piracy has decreased by 25 per cent in the country due to the proliferation of OTT services with high quality content and the crackdown on TV pirates.
